The Netherlands is the ultimate place for cultural holidays. Experience a distinctively Dutch mix of old and new, traditional and cutting edge in a host of cities where culture is ever-evolving.
The capital city of The Netherlands is located in the province of Noord-Holland. The political city is The Hague and is located in Zuid-Holland. Aside from Amsterdam and The Hague other big cities in the Randstad are Leiden, Rotterdam, Utrecht, Haarlem, Delft and Gouda.
